Spring lake trout on Duthorne Lake hold shallow, usually 10 to 40 ft. By summer they slide out to 21 to 69 ft, and by winter most fish are in 17 to 69 ft. Deep basin is the standout, a deep basin at roughly 59 ft, rated prime for summer lake trout. Best bite is early morning. Summer baits: a white tube jig (deep) or a magnum spoon on downrigger gets it done.
| Season | Depth | Best window | Go-to baits |
|---|---|---|---|
| Spring | 10 to 40 ft | dawn & dusk | Casting spoon over shoals, Jerkbait (shallow) |
| Summer | 21 to 69 ft | dawn | White tube jig (deep), Magnum spoon on downrigger |
| Fall | 10 to 50 ft | dusk & dawn | Heavy casting spoon, Jigging rap over reefs |
| Winter | 17 to 69 ft | dawn | White tube jig, Airplane jig |
